Product Description
MODEL
RFL-A3000D
Laser parameter
output power W)
3000
work model
continuous
polariszation
at random
power adjustment(%)
10~100
wave length(nm)
915±10
output unstablility(%)
<3
Rate(Hz)
50~5k
red light point power(mW)
0.25~1
laser head parameters
output head mode
QBH
fiber core(μm)
600
Min bend semidiameter(mm)
≥400
Half angle of beam divergence(rad)
≤0.22
fiber length(m)
20
electronic parameters
Voltage
AC380V±38V,50/60Hz,
control mode
RS-232/AD
other parameters
size (W×H×D)(mm)
650×950×980
weight(Kg)
<150
temperature(ºC)
10~40
Hunidity(%)
<70
storage(ºC)
-10~60
Cooling
Water cooling
Power consumption
22KW
